Ruins of Alcalá la Vieja Fortress

Highlight • Historical Site

Alcalá la Vieja is the name given to the Arab fortress al-Qal'at abd al-Salam after the recovery of the territory by the Archbishop of Toledo in 1118. The term "the fortress" in Arabic (al-Qal'at ) is what today gives its name to the modern city (built around the Burgo de Santiuste, on the right bank of the river).

It is part of the set of sites that can be visited in the Community of Madrid, although it is currently fenced off and you have to settle for seeing it from the fence.

Valmores Fountain

Highlight • Monument

The Valmores fountain, an Asset of Heritage Interest of the Community of Madrid, is a good example of the historical sources existing in the region, closely linked to livestock farming and the livestock routes that facilitated the movement of herds through the territory. It is attached to the base of a bank, a wide unproductive slope that links dry fields arranged at different levels, and preserves the original catchment system intact, maintaining an acceptable flow.

Pioz Castle

Highlight • Castle

Interesting work of the s. XV, which allows us to appreciate how a castle was arranged when the use of artillery had already been imposed: harquebuses and cannons. It is erected on a plain, and preserves both its interior and towers, as well as the outer enclosure and the moat.

Free access to the outside. To visit the interior, contact the Pioz town hall, telephone 949.272.076.

The Valmores watering hole was restored in 2022, recovering an essential piece in the ethnographic heritage of Pezuela de las Torres. The first references to the fountain appear in the Topographic Relations of 1578. In 1735, reforms and improvements were made to the original spring, making it essential in the daily life of the countryside. The construction has a functional design to water livestock at a crossroads of the Alcarreño moor with trees and benches to take a break.

The ethnographic complex of the Fuente Grande de Corpa is an important element of the local heritage. It was built in 1897 by local stonemasons Francisco and Vicente, according to an inscription attached to the wall of the watering hole. The water reaches the stone basins from two different springs in an old cattle rest area at the Cordel de la Senda de la Galiana, although there had been a powerful spring for a long time before. The largest pond was a public washhouse and one of the jets has its own name, it is the Collantes spout and was an old war cannon.

What historical sites can I explore in Los Santos de la Humosa?

Los Santos de la Humosa is rich in history. You can visit the impressive Church of San Pedro Apóstol, a blend of Gothic and Renaissance styles, or the baroque Hermitage of the Virgen de la Humosa. Don't miss the Ruins of Alcalá la Vieja Fortress, an ancient Muslim city, and the 15th-century Pioz Castle, which preserves its interior, towers, and moat.

Where can I find the best panoramic views around Los Santos de la Humosa?

The town is known for its spectacular viewpoints. Head to the Mirador de la Visera for magnificent views, including the Sierra del Ocejón. The Mirador del Pico Peñabermeja offers extensive vistas of the entire Community of Madrid, while the Balcones del Castillejo Bajo and the Park of Miguel Ángel Blanco also provide excellent scenic spots overlooking the Henares valley and the Sierra de Guadarrama.

Are there any unique cultural buildings to see?

Beyond the churches and hermitages, you can admire the Benita Santos Juarranz Foundation Building and the Casa de la Cultura, both showcasing a distinctive Neo-Mudéjar architectural style. The Bridge over the Henares River, inaugurated in 1888, is also a significant historical structure.

Are there any archaeological or paleontological sites nearby?

Yes, the area around Los Santos de la Humosa has a rich past. Archaeological sites with findings from the Bronze Age and Roman villas have been discovered. Additionally, paleontological sites in the vicinity have yielded fossils of reptiles and mammals, offering insights into ancient life in the region.
